EPE,

1 Lb. filleted BG
1 TSP Salt
1 TSp Pepper
1 Cup Corn Meal
1/2 Cup Flour
1 Can Beer (cooks choice)

- Peanut Oil (1 Quart)
- Large Deep Fryer

Heat Oil to 400 degrees.
Mix Dry ingredients in 1 Gallon zip lock bag.
Add 1 LB of fish filets.
Shake well.
Drop into Deep Fryer.
Drink Beer.
Serve.
Repeat.

Remember not to make the batter very far ahead of the time you want to use it. The point of the beer is the bubbles released into the batter during cooking from carbonation of the beer. This aerates the batter and makes it light serving the same function as baking soda or powder.
